The Eagle cassette features 12 sprockets ranging from 10 to 50 teeth. With this gear range, you can harness the benefits of the 1x12-speed drivetrain on any terrain, on any surface and at any speed.
SRAM GX Eagle Grip Shift twist shifters:
New Grip Shift mechanism for greater precision and durability – the original from SRAM taken to a new level. With SRAM’s Jaws Lock-On grip technology, the shifter and grip are connected as a single unit, offering extreme security. Easy to fit and remove. Rolling Thunder ball bearing technology consists of three rows of ball bearings with 120 balls, guaranteeing minimal effort when shifting, zero friction or play, and long-term performance in all weather conditions.
SRAM GX Eagle Grip Shift 12-speed shift lever technology:
- Aluminium housing
- Stainless steel internals
- Ball-bearing rotating parts
- CNC-machined aluminium clamp
- Impulse shifting technology: 1:1 ratio, compatible with SRAM rear derailleurs and SRAM/Shimano derailleur
- Weight: 105 grams (shift levers), 80 grams (rubber grips)
- The SRAM GX Eagle shifter is only compatible with SRAM 12-speed rear derailleurs
Contents: SRAM GX Grip Shift
SRAM GX Eagle twist grip, right and left grip pads, inner cable
